dasH #1: tHe idea
                                       “The purest
  • 1990: 24-year old Joanne            stroke of
    Rowling imagines Harry Potter   inspiration I’ve
                                    ever had in my
    out of thin air.
                                     life.” - J.K. Rowling
  • 1995: Destitute single-mother completes the
    final draft of the first Harry Potter book.
  • 1996: Rowling visits the library to get
    publisher addresses. She submits Harry Potter
    to one and is rejected. The second accepts.

dasH #2: tHe literary agent
 • Early 1996: Byrony Evans of
   the Christopher Little Agency
   notices Rowling’s submission.
 • Late 1996: After 12 publisher
   rejections, Barry Cunningham
   of Bloomsbury accepts Harry
   Potter and the Philosopher’s
   Stone.
 • 1997:Joanne becomes J.K.
   Rowling. 500 copies published
   for $6,500 advance.

dasH #3: tHe u.s. PuBlisHer
 • 1997: Arthur Levine of Scholastic stumbles
   on the first Harry Potter book. Pays
   $105,000 advance for U.S. publishing rights.
 • Late 1997: 70,000 copies of the book sold in
   Great Britain ($7,500 to Rowling).
 • July 1998: Harry Potter and the Chamber of
   Secrets debuts in Great Britain at #1.
 • August 1998: Book 1 released in U.S. as
   Harry Potter and the Sorcerer’s Stone.
 • Late 1998: 190,000 copies sold in U.S.

sales keeP going uP
    • July 1999: Scholastic release second book in
      U.S. and third book, Harry Potter and the
      Prisoner of Azkaban, released in Great Britain
      (sold more than 60,000 copies in first three
      days).
    • September 1999: Third book released in U.S.
    • Late 1999: Harry Potter books are worldwide
      bestsellers with nearly 30 million copies in
      print in 27 languages. Rowling receives first
      royalty check over $1 million.

Movie studies CoMe Calling
    • 1998-1999: Movie studios pitch Rowling who
      refuses offers from several studios. Warner
      Brothers agrees to meet her requirements and
      movie and merchandising contract signed for
      $1 million.
    • July 8, 2000: Fourth book, Harry Potter and
      the Goblet of Fire, released around the world
      at midnight.
    • November 2001: First movie opens.

Harry Potter Books By tHe
              nuMBers – u.s. only
     Book      Date     First Print   Amazon / B&N First 24-hour
                        Run           Pre-orders   Sales
     1         1998     50,000        n/a           Unknown

     2         1999     250,000       n/a           Unknown

     3         1999     500,000       n/a           Unknown

     4         2000     3.8 million   760,000       1.0 million
     5         2003     8.5 million   1.4 million   5.0 million

     6         2005     10.8 million 1.5 million    6.9 million

     7         2007     12 million    2.2 million   8.3 million

seleCted Harry Potter
                advertising sPending
    • Source: Nielsen, July 2000 news release
         Book advertising = $3.5 million
         Movie advertising = $142.7 million
         DVD/video advertising = $68.5 million
         Merchandise/cross-promotion advertising =
          $54 million

6. Brand ConsistenCy and
                    restraint
    • All brand touch points must communicate
      consistent brand message, image and promise.
    • J.K. Rowling as brand guardian and brand
      champion
    • Brand restraint means not overextending the
      brand -- No Harry Potter on Happy Meals
    • Less merchandised than many other brands at
      time such as Shrek and Cars
    • Limiting brand extensions left fans wanting
      more and fed into pull marketing/tease and
      perpetual marketing strategies

PotterMore’s first 14 days
    • Pottermore launched with content for the first
      book only and limited interactivity with a
      tease of more to come.
    • First two weeks after Pottermore launched:
           22 million visits
           7 million unique visitors
           1 billion page impressions
           Average visitor viewed 47 pages
           Average visitor spent 25 minutes on the site
           5 million people registered
           250,000 registered members had been sorted into
            Hogwarts houses.
